Fisker to provide vehicles for EV-subscription service in UK

Fisker Inc. has partnered with Onto, the U.K.-based all-inclusive electric-car subscription service for private and business users.

The agreement, the first multi-vehicle reservation for Fisker in the U.K. market, supports the delivery of up to 700 vehicles in 2023. Onto will be Fisker’s first customer in the UK and the exclusive rental/subscription partner for 2023.

Onto says through a monthly subscription, customers get the latest EVs with insurance, public charging and servicing all included. Onto has an active fleet of more than 3,000 vehicles in operation with both private and business customers across the United Kingdom.

In December 2020, Fisker announced a partnership with Cox Automotive and Rivus for delivery, servicing, fleet management and reselling programs in the U.K. The Fisker Ocean SUV is being engineered for both left. and right-hand-drive versions, with deliveries projected to start in the U.K. during the first half of 2023.

The company also previously confirmed that the first Fisker experience center in the U.K. would be opened in London during 2022. The global reveal of the Fisker Ocean will be at the Los Angeles Auto Show in November 2021 – with start of production and deliveries of left-hand-drive versions in Q4 2022.
